Zuhause Entwicklung Was ist Linux, Apache, MySQL und Perl / PHP / Python (Lampe)? - Definition aus techopedia

Was ist Linux, Apache, MySQL und Perl / PHP / Python (Lampe)? - Definition aus techopedia

Inhaltsverzeichnis:

Anonim

Definition - Was bedeuten Linux, Apache, MySQL und Perl / PHP / Python (LAMP)?

Linux, Apache, MySQL und Perl / PHP / Python ist ein Lösungsstapel, der am häufigsten unter der Abkürzung "LAMP" bezeichnet wird. Es ist eine Open Source-Entwicklungsplattform zum Erstellen und Verwalten von Webanwendungen.


Linux dient als Backend-Betriebssystem (OS). Apache ist der Webserver, MySQL ist die Datenbank und PHP, Perl, Python ist die Skriptsprache. PHP ist die beliebteste der drei Skriptsprachen.

Techopedia erklärt Linux, Apache, MySQL und Perl / PHP / Python (LAMP)

Die LAMP-Entwicklungsplattform ist ein äußerst beliebter Lösungsstapel. Der vielleicht bedeutendste Grund für seine weit verbreitete Verwendung ist, dass alle Komponenten des Stacks Open Source sind und daher kostenlos verwendet werden können.


Darüber hinaus schafft die Popularität eine starke Entwicklergemeinschaft, die als Hilfsmittel für neue Entwickler dient. Das Erlernen der Grundlagen von LAMP reicht aus, um einen Entwickler an den Punkt zu bringen, an dem er eine recht komplexe Website starten kann. Das heißt, Websites auf Unternehmensebene würden eine Reihe anderer Technologien beinhalten, aber obwohl LAMP Open Source ist, ist dies für die überwiegende Mehrheit der Websites mehr als ausreichend.


Es folgen LAMP-Varianten mit ersetzten Betriebssystemen:

  • WAMP unter Windows.
  • MAMP unter Macintosh.
  • SAMP unter Verwendung einer Solaris-basierten Plattform.
Was ist Linux, Apache, MySQL und Perl / PHP / Python (Lampe)? - Definition aus techopedia